We are offering a reward of up to $5 million for info leading to the arrest of 4 individuals wanted for their alleged role in the brutal 2017 murders of UN experts in the #DRC. Write to us via WhatsApp +1-202-975-5468 if you have any info.

Attention Ukrainians: @coe's Register of Damage for 🇺🇦 has launched a new claims category. You can now submit claims for the death of an immediate family member due to Russia's war of aggression. The 🇺🇸is proud to support the Register of Damage #JusticeforUkraine (1/3)
🔵🟡 Category A2.1 now OPEN at #RD4U: Individuals who have lost immediate family members due to Russia’s full-scale invasion can now submit their #claims to the Register of Damage for #Ukraine.
